Rapid aqueous-phase oxidation of an <i>α</i>-pinene-derived organosulfate by hydroxyl radicals: a potential source of some unclassified oxygenated and small organosulfates in the atmosphere
<p>Organosulfates (OSs) are ubiquitously present in atmospheric aerosols and cloud droplets, and affect aerosol-cloud-climate interactions via their distinct physicochemical properties.
